testlink 1.9.3升级至1.9.6的完全手册

testlink 1.9.3升级至1.9.6的完全手册

ID:1970553

大小:96.15 KB

页数:5页

时间:2017-11-14

testlink 1.9.3升级至1.9.6的完全手册_第1页
testlink 1.9.3升级至1.9.6的完全手册_第2页
testlink 1.9.3升级至1.9.6的完全手册_第3页
testlink 1.9.3升级至1.9.6的完全手册_第4页
testlink 1.9.3升级至1.9.6的完全手册_第5页
资源描述:

《testlink 1.9.3升级至1.9.6的完全手册》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、Testlink1.9.3升级至1.9.6的完全手册Testlink从1.9.3升级到1.9.6,性能上有所优化,也修改了原来的部分缺陷,本次升级不支持自动升级,需要手动升级。一、更新安装环境Testlink1.9.6要求软件环境分别为:-web-server:Apache1.2,2.x-PHP5.3-DBMS:MySQL5.x,Postgres8.x,9.x,MS-SQL2005/2008如果原来的环境版本没有到位的话,需要升级,否则部署会不成功。二、数据迁移由于数据库结构的变化,需要手动升级,升级步骤如

2、下:1.备份TestLink1.9.3数据库使用客户端导出SQL语句即可,存放在本地路径2.安装TestLink1.9.4程序包安装步骤具体见:http://www.blogjava.net/lijun_li/archive/2012/11/29/392224.html3.导入TestLink1.9.3数据库1.创建新的数据库用于导入备份的数据库,例如testlink196(使用客户端新建数据库的话,需注意把数据库的字符类型改为UTF-8,否则导入后会乱码)2.将备份的testlink1.9.3的数据导入新

3、建的数据库3.使用客户端,打开新建的数据库,找出安装包中的以下SQL文件,依次执行:-1.9.3升级至1.9.4/5a)install/sql/alter_tables/1.9.4//DB.1.5/step1/db_schema_update.sqlb)install/sql/alter_tables/1.9.4//DB.1.5/stepZ/z_final_step.sql-1.9.4/5升级至1.9.6a)install/sql/alter_tables/1.9.6/<

4、your_db>/DB.1.6/step1/db_schema_update.sqlb)install/sql/alter_tables/1.9.6//DB.1.6/stepZ/z_final_step.sql如果testlink原先的版本过低,请先把数据库升级至1.9.3,升级方法类似4.更新TestLink1.9.6配置文件进入新安装的TestLink1.9.6数据库配置文件,更新链接的数据库链接到testlink_196:编辑Testlink目录下的config_db.inc.php

5、,修改’DB_NAME’的值为:testlink196保存后在浏览器访问testlink,使用之前的老用户账户登录,能成功登录进去并看到之前的测试用例和测试计划。5.更新缺失的数据库表对比备份的TestLink1.9.3和新安装的TestLink1.9.6数据库表,发现还需要在testlink_new增加以下视图:last_executionslast_executions_by_platformtcversions_last_active_bare_bones执行以下SQL语句即可:CREATEVIEW/

6、*prefix*/last_executionsAS(SELECTtcversion_id,testplan_id,platform_id,build_id,MAX(id)ASidFROM/*prefix*/executionsGROUPbytcversion_id,testplan_id,platform_id,build_id);CREATEVIEW/*prefix*/last_executions_by_platformAS(SELECTE.tcversion_id,E.testplan_id,E.p

7、latform_id,MAX(E.id)ASidFROM/*prefix*/executionsEJOIN/*prefix*/buildsBONB.active=1ANDB.testplan_id=E.testplan_idGROUPbytcversion_id,testplan_id,platform_id);CREATEVIEW/*prefix*/tcversions_last_active_bare_bonesAS(SELECTNHTCV.parent_idAStcase_id,max(TCV.id)

8、AStcversion_idFROM/*prefix*/nodes_hierarchyNHTCVJOIN/*prefix*/tcversionsTCVONTCV.id=NHTCV.idWHERETCV.active=1GROUPBYNHTCV.parent_id,TCV.tc_external_id);三.缺陷关联配置Testlink1.9.6的关联缺陷系统可以在页面进行配置,而不像以前的版本,需要在源代码中进行

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。